Output d84f669abbd6bbb1e6a6bbf17f5c22acf7849063722bfaaf4e22b396d4edec54:1

value
16043
script pubkey
OP_0 OP_PUSHBYTES_20 5d44b477feb991304d0b0e4af07749b6b2985958
address
tb1qt4ztgal7hxgnqngtpe90qa6fk6efsk2cqauhdf
transaction
d84f669abbd6bbb1e6a6bbf17f5c22acf7849063722bfaaf4e22b396d4edec54
confirmations
68702
spent
true